I recently wired up a 4age into an adm sprinter and i had to put a relay on the fuel pump that was triggerd by the circuit opening relay (C-O-R) as the positive side of a pump will allow earth leakage and the charge from the C-O-R isnt strong/constant enough to switch the pump even tho its 12v's.
